William H Clement was born on December 20,1950 and is a Canadian former professional ice hockey player who became an author, speaker, actor, entrepreneur, and hockey broadcaster.

Bill Clement spent his first four years with the Philadelphia Flyers, with whom he won two Stanley Cup championships.

Bill Clement later played for the Washington Capitals, whom he captained, and the Flames, both in Atlanta and Calgary.

Bill Clement has broadcast five different Olympic Games and has worked for ESPN, NBC, ABC, Versus, Comcast SportsNet and TNT in the US, and CTV, CBC, Rogers Sportsnet and Sirius XM Radio in Canada.

Bill Clement's acting credits include work on the ABC daytime drama All My Children and more than 300 television ads for clients such as Chevrolet, Bud Light, and Deepwoods Off.

Bill Clement was one of the in-game announcers on EA Sports' NHL video games from NHL 07 through NHL 14, as well as on 2K Sports' NHL 2K series in ESPN NHL Hockey and ESPN NHL 2K5.

Bill Clement played Junior Hockey with the Ottawa 67s of the O H A, in their first three seasons.

Bill Clement worked with Jim Lampley as a studio analyst for NBC during their coverage of both the men's and women's ice hockey tournaments at the 2002 Winter Olympics in Salt Lake City.

Bill Clement worked as the play-by-play announcer for table tennis, pentathlon events, and badminton tournaments for the 2004 and 2008 Summer Olympics for NBC.

In January 2021, Bill Clement announced his retirement from broadcasting at the age of 70.
